Regional Defence Investment Initiative
Operator
Sponsor or operator: Pacific Economic Development Canada
DeliveringMar 31, 2026Organization role. Regional repayable and non-repayable support for eligible defence and dual-use businesses and ecosystem projects in British Columbia.
Program. Regional repayable and non-repayable support for eligible defence and dual-use businesses and ecosystem projects in British Columbia.
